TLDR : Answer Summary
In response to a question about the best city for a one-day trip out of Thailand to obtain a 30-day visa stamp, several options were suggested by the community. Kuala Lumpur and Penang emerged as popular choices due to low flight costs and visa exemptions for many nationalities. Other recommended destinations included Siem Reap and Vientiane, with assorted comments about the experiences, costs, and travel logistics involved. The conversation also highlighted the potential risks and requirements, suggesting that travelers consider booking flights that allow for same-day returns to avoid complications with Thai immigration.

Nongnuch ********
@Michael *******
totally normal price, it includes the long trip (385 kilometers one way!), a lunch, the visa fee for Myanmar and the boat transfer to the Casino and back. It takes 10 hours. You could do a "border run" from Pattaya to Cambodia with an agent for around 3600.- THB, though. You could try it yourself but be warned you might get stranded in Cambodia
